Output 84b22369978652598feee23676337be6a658f7433328baef6f2a74bb6d5a0264:0

value
1009410
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38edba06cced987b24e7931eccf2880279f5e532 OP_EQUALVERIFY OP_CHECKSIG
address
16C1dHHmkPmUXzLEKfVV1EUhghbQ1mm6Rj
transaction
84b22369978652598feee23676337be6a658f7433328baef6f2a74bb6d5a0264
spent
true